This film produced for the Danish Red Cross described the implementation of a primary health care program in remote areas of Northern Laos.

Most hill-tribe people live up in the mountains or in remote villages along the banks of the Ou river. They have little or no access to health care, education or possibilities of earning an income. Consequently, the population suffers from a variety of health related problems.

The film, funded through the Danish Red Cross in cooperation with the Lao Red Cross was shot on Betacam SP and edited at Living Films. One of the challenges was to work with interviews in local dialects and produce subtitled language versions in Lao, Danish and English language.
